Memories of Moneta

Spencer author publishes history book on O'Brien County hamlet

You wouldn't know by looking at it now, but Moneta used to be a bustling enclave of commerce, development and hope.

The tiny town on O'Brien County's far east border once boasted a population nearing 500 people. Residents there enjoyed all the amenities folks in larger cities took for granted – a movie theater, two car dealerships, grocery stores, gas station, school, bank, pool hall and more.

For Vicky Treimer, Moneta's rise and fall has been a point of curiosity her whole life.

"I was always fascinated by the town," she said. "The history just totally fascinated me, even as a young girl at 6...
